Choosing the Right Destination

One of the most crucial steps in planning a summer vacation is selecting the right destination. This decision can set the tone for your entire trip, so it’s essential to consider your preferences and interests. Are you drawn to the tranquility of a beach, the hustle and bustle of a city, or the serene beauty of the mountains?

For those who seek sun-soaked relaxation, coastal destinations offer stunning beaches and a chance to unwind by the sea. Popular choices include tropical islands, where you can indulge in water sports or simply bask in the sun. If cultural exploration is more your style, cities with rich histories and vibrant arts scenes might be ideal. Here, you can visit museums, enjoy local cuisine, and immerse yourself in the local culture.

For adventure enthusiasts, mountainous regions offer hiking, biking, and opportunities to connect with nature. Consider destinations that provide a mix of activities, allowing you to tailor your vacation to your interests. A few points to consider when choosing a destination include:

  • Weather conditions during your travel dates
  • Budget and cost of living in the area
  • Travel restrictions or entry requirements
  • Availability of activities and attractions

By taking these factors into account, you can ensure that your summer vacation is both enjoyable and memorable.

Planning and Budgeting Your Trip

Once you’ve chosen a destination, the next step is to plan and budget your trip. Effective planning can help you make the most of your vacation while staying within your financial means. Start by outlining a rough itinerary, considering the duration of your stay and the activities you wish to include.

Accommodation is a significant aspect of your budget. Research various options, from hotels and resorts to vacation rentals and hostels, to find one that suits your needs and budget. Booking in advance can often secure better rates and availability, especially in popular tourist areas.

Transportation is another critical component. Consider whether you’ll need to rent a car, rely on public transport, or use other means of getting around. Factor in the cost of flights or other travel expenses to ensure you’re prepared.

It’s also wise to allocate funds for meals, activities, and unexpected expenses. Consider dining at local eateries to experience authentic cuisine at a lower cost. Look for discounts or passes to attractions, which can save you money while allowing you to explore more.

By carefully planning and budgeting, you can enjoy a stress-free summer vacation that meets your expectations and financial constraints.
